Start with verified information
A supply contract and a solar project solve different parts of the cost equation. The contract governs imported electricity; solar can reduce the amount imported when the system is generating and the site is using power.
Make the options comparable
That is why interval data and operating hours matter. A roof can accommodate a large array, but the most valuable design is normally the one aligned with the site's real consumption and export position.
Plan the decision before the deadline
Contract dates, proposed project timing and any supplier obligations should be reviewed together. Joined-up planning reduces the chance of one decision undermining another.
